Bradley Barcola a long-standing Liverpool target

Before moving to PSG, Barcola made a name for himself at Lyon, where his devastating pace, dribbling ability and silky feet were on display week in and week out.

In the summer of 2023, the Parisian giants took a major punt on him as they agreed to pay a fee of €45m for a relatively inexperienced player.

And it’s safe to say their trust in Barcola has been vindicated as the French international has become a key player for club and country over the years, with his value skyrocketing to over €100m.

Liverpool tried to sign Barcola last summer, but PSG were unwilling to sell and the Reds decided to press ahead with deals for Florian Wirtz, Hugo Ekitike and Alexander Isak, among others.
